additional information | [Ruminococcus] gnavus | in vivo, the forward reaction that produces ursodeoxycholic acid from 7-oxo-lithocholic acid is observed to have a growth-dependent conversion rate of 90-100% after culture in anaerobic medium broth containing 1 mM 7-oxo-lithocholic acid, while the reverse reaction is undetectable. The purified 7beta-HSDH shows a kcat/Km value that is about 55fold higher for the forward reaction than for the reverse reaction, indicating that the enzyme favors the UDCA producing reaction | ? | - |

additional information | strain N53 converts 7-oxo-lithocholic acid to ursodeoxycholic acid, and the conversion rates peaks during stationary phase, suggesting that the reductive conversion reaction is growth-dependent. In contrast, when strain N53 is cultured in the presence of ursodeoxycholic acid, 7-oxo-lithocholic acid is not detected | [Ruminococcus] gnavus | - |

General Information | Comment | Organism |
---|---|---|
physiological function | the 7beta-hydroxysteroid dehydrogenase from Ruminococcus gnavus strain N53 (ATCC 29149) contributes to ursodeoxycholic acid formation in the human colon | [Ruminococcus] gnavus |
